1 DEPARTMENT OF THE AIR FORCE HEADQUARTERS UNITED STATES AIR FORCE WASHINGTON DC AFI _AFGM1 29 August 2014 MEMORANDUM FOR DISTRIBUTION C MAJCOMs/FOAs/DRUs FROM: HQ USAF/A4/ Air Force Pentagon Washington, DC SUBJECT: Air Force Guidance Memorandum to AFI , Management of Government Property in Possession of the Air Force By order of the Secretary of the Air Force, this Guidance Memorandum implements requirements of the Wing or Group Commanders (or equivalent) to appoint all Accountable Property Officers (APO) in writing, APO s will request appointment letters from Unit Commanders designating Property Custodians and Property Custodians will be appointed by Unit Commanders to manage government property IAW AFI , Management of Government Property in Possession of the Air Force, 29 October To the extent its directions are inconsistent with other Air Force publications; the information herein prevails, in accordance with AFI , Publications and Forms Management. The change is required to ensure the Wing or Group Commanders (or equivalent) appoint all Accountable Property Officers (APO) in writing, that APO s will request appointment letters from Unit Commanders designating Property Custodians and that Property Custodians will be appointed by the Unit Commander to manage government property. This memorandum will be implemented in the published version of AFI as coordinated and approved in this memo. The approved language will be inserted in the current published AFI (Chapter 2). This memorandum becomes void after one year has elapsed from the date of this memorandum, or upon publication of an Interim Change or rewrite of the affected publication, whichever is earlier. A Changes to AFI , Chapter 2 includes: (Updated) Accountable Property Officer (APO) (comparable to the Accountable Officer (AO). An accountable property officer is an individual who, based on his or her training, knowledge, and experience in property management, accountability and control procedures, is appointed by proper authority to establish and maintain an organization s accountable property records, systems, and/or financial records, in connection with Government property, irrespective of whether the property is in the individual's possession. The APO will request appointment letters from Unit Commanders designating Property Custodians. These responsibilities cannot be delegated. ANG is an exception as stated in Para 5 of this instruction. The Accountable Base Medical Supply Officer will adhere to guidance specified in AFI , Medical Logistics Support (T-2). Refer to DoD R for depot wholesale and depot retail responsibilities. (Updated) Property Custodian. An individual appointed by the Unit Commander, who accepts custodial responsibility for property, typically by signing a custodial receipt. The property custodian is directly responsible for the physical custody of accountable property under their control. (Updated) Appoint all APOs in writing. 2

Finally, administrative revisions were made in the Title Page, to change DoD M to DLM M to accurately update this Instruction. Section A General Property Management 1. Statutory Authority. Title 10, U.S.C., 2788, authorizes the Secretary of the Air Force to prescribe publications for the accounting and assignment of responsibility for Air Force property. Title 32, U.S.C., 710 identifies the State s responsibilities for managing federal property issued to the National Guard All military and civilian personnel will operate and maintain government systems, equipment, and supplies in the best possible condition, in constant readiness, and in the absolute minimum quantities necessary to accomplish assigned tasks. (T-2) 1.2. Air Force property managers will provide the proper allocation, control, use, and safeguard of property under Air Force control. (T-2) All persons entrusted with the management of government property shall comply with paragraph 4 of DoDI , Accountability and Management of DoD Equipment and Other Accountable Property. (T-2) 1.3. Supply Discipline is mandatory for all personnel. Subordinate Commanders are responsible to their commanders for ensuring effective Supply Discipline Government property includes equipment, military equipment, and other accountable property (e.g., administrative property, special tools, and special test equipment). Other types of personal property, such as supplies, material, and records, are not included unless expressly stated as being included Property management, in relation to property accountability referenced in Volume 1, Appendix 2 of DLM , responsibility includes the determination or assessment of pecuniary liability for the loss, damage, or destruction of property resulting from negligence due to willful misconduct or deliberate unauthorized use In the Air National Guard, the United States Property and Fiscal Officers (USPFO) are the primary accountable officers in accordance with Title 32 U.S.C They are nominated by the Governor of each state and territory, Puerto Rico, or the commanding general of the National Guard of the District of Columbia, and appointed by the Secretaries of the Army and the Air Force. They are also commissioned officers of the Army/Air National Guard of the United States. They and their duly appointed assistant USPFOs for Property are responsible for receiving and accounting for all government property in possession of the Air National Guard. All other provisions of this Instruction, as it pertains to accountability and management of government property apply to the Air National Guard. Consistent with Title 32 U.S.C. 710, all military property issued by the United States to the National Guard remains the property of the United States.

5 AFI OCTOBER Section B Roles and Responsibilities 2. Roles and Responsibilities. DoD and Air Force policy provides for varying levels of roles and responsibility when managing or controlling government property In addition to the general responsibilities applicable to all Air Force personnel IAW DoDI R, establish the appointment, in writing, of the following property accountability echelons: Accountable Property Officer (APO) (comparable to the Accountable Officer (AO)). An accountable property officer is an individual who, based on his or her training, knowledge, and experience in property management, accountability and control procedures, is appointed by proper authority to establish and maintain an organization s accountable property records, systems, and/or financial records, in connection with Government property, irrespective of whether the property is in the individual's possession. These responsibilities cannot be delegated. ANG is an exception as stated in Para 5 of this instruction. The Accountable Base Medical Supply Officer will adhere to guidance specified in AFI , Medical Logistics Support (T-2). Refer to DoD R for depot wholesale and depot retail responsibilities Property Custodian. An individual appointed by the APO, who accepts custodial responsibility for property, typically by signing a hand-receipt. The property custodian is directly responsible for the physical custody of accountable property under their control Wing or Group Commanders (or equivalent) Responsibilities for Management of Government Property Wing or Group Commanders (or equivalent) will: (T-1) Appoint all property custodians in writing Include the identification of the specific record account or functional area of responsibility, specific expectations, and mandatory requirement to comply with policy and guidance in AFPD 23-1 and this Instruction Determine when re-appointment is necessary in absence of an accountable officer Accountable Property Officer Responsibilities for Management of Government Property Accountable Property Officers will: (T-2) Oversee all appropriate record in an Accountable Property System of Record (APSR). See attachment 3 for list of APSR s Ensure property accountability is enabled by item unique identification (IUID) and Automatic Identification Technology (AIT) IAW DoDI and DoDI Perform inventories of accountable property under their purview at periods prescribed in DoDI Identify the proper urgency and validity of requests for material in accordance with DoD R.

6 4 AFI OCTOBER Properly identify, reporting, and determining correct disposition of unserviceable, reparable, or excess property Validate the accuracy of accountable records and the validity of property locations Provide effective management, direction, and controls for committing or obligating public funds Provide guidance and training on accountability standards to custodians, and other personnel, as required Provide guidance on required contingency location closure actions under their purview Property Custodian Responsibilities for Management of Government Property Property Custodians will: (T-2) Manually and/or automatically track and record transactions affecting Classes of Supply under their functional control Automatically and/or manually report APSR adjustments to the designated accountable officer Identify, report, disposition of serviceable, unserviceable, reparable, and excess materiel Maintain and secure auditable and/or accountable documents Initiate Reports of Survey. Refer to AFMAN , Reports of Survey for Air Force Property, for guidance on reports of survey Manage contingency location closure actions affecting their respective Classes of Supply Plan and forecast requirements to meet mission goals Prepare and forward materiel requests to the proper agency or individuals Sign custody receipts or listings for property charged to their organization Report losses or irregularities relating to property to immediate commanders and APO s Take action to reconcile and correct property records Report unusual purchase patterns to commanders Personnel having custodial responsibility may be held pecuniary liable for the loss, destruction, or damage to property caused by willful misconduct, deliberate unauthorized use, or negligence in the use, care, custody, or safeguard of the property from causes other than normal wear and tear Provide evidence of responsibility for management of government property at designated levels of command by:

7 AFI OCTOBER Properly documented and itemized physical inventories taken at required intervals. Inventories will be performed in a floor-to-book style Maintaining a copy of each document or computer record that confirms acquisition or movement of property Maintaining certificates of transfer between responsible/accountable personnel. Temporary issues will be tracked using the AF Form 1297, Temporary Issue Receipt Commanders/Directors will: (T-2) Ensure all personnel carefully and economically use and safeguard property Provide adequate security, protection, and storage for property Ensure accountable property that is not identified on an APSR (i.e. items found on base) is recorded IAW DoDI regardless of how property was acquired and delivered to the owning organization Supervisors and Subordinates will: (T-2) Accurately record/maintain accountable property in an APSR to reflect current inventory, location and condition Adjust records to reflect all discovered shortages and make adjustments IAW AFI , Air Force Materiel Management and AFMAN , Materiel Management Procedures (when published) Make recommendations to accountable officers for the prevention and correction of Fraud, Waste, and Abuse activity Government property that does not require APSR recording, such as Government Purchase Card (GPC) will be recorded and accounted for at the unit level Relief from Custodial Responsibility. Commanders provide relief from custodial responsibility with: Documents or computer records showing turn-in or transfer of items to another custodian Approved reports that provide for disposition of, or relief from responsibility for items that have become unusable due to damage, loss, deterioration, obsolescence, or destruction Approved inventory adjustments, or a prescribed document to adjust losses incidental to normal operations. 10 8 AFI OCTOBER 2013 USPFO United States Property and Fiscal Officer Terms Accountable Property Officer An individual who, based on his or her training, knowledge, and experience in property management, accountability and control procedures, is appointed by proper authority to establish and maintain an organization s accountable property records, systems, and/or financial records, in connection with Government property, irrespective of whether the property is in the individual's possession. Accountable Property Property that meets accountability requirements and is recorded in the APSR. Accountable property is referenced in DoDI APSR The Government system used to control and manage accountable property records; a subset of existing organizational processes related to the lifecycle management of property; the system that is integrated with the core financial system. Property All references to property contained herein include equipment, military equipment, and other accountable property (e.g., administrative property, special tools, special test equipment). Other types of personal property, such as supplies, material, and records, are not included unless expressly stated as being included. Property Custodian An individual appointed by the APO, who accepts custodial responsibility for property, typically by signing a hand-receipt. The property custodian is directly responsible for the physical custody of accountable property under their control. Property Management A monitoring and control function, charged with assuring that organization processes related to the lifecycle of property support organization objectives, represent sound business practice, and are compliant with applicable standards, policies, regulations, and contractual requirements. Also, the system of acquiring, maintaining, using and disposing of the personal property of an organization or entity. Supply Discipline The control, cost-effective use, protection and availability of government systems, equipment, and supplies for operational requirements.

11 AFI OCTOBER Attachment 2 APPOINTMENT QUALIFICATIONS FOR ACCOUNTABLE POSITIONS, BY TYPE ACCOUNT A2.1. Logistics Readiness Squadron (LRS) (FB/FE). The LRS Commander is the accountable officer for supply system stocks in FB/FE accounts and also serves as the Nuclear Weapons- Related Materiel Accountable Officer (NWRMAO). At locations where an LRS is not assigned, the NWRMAO may be a US military officer, US SNCO, or Department of the Air Force (DAF) civilian (US Citizen) in the grade of GS-11 (minimum). They must complete the NWRMAO training requirement IAW AFI , Nuclear Weapons-Related Materiel Management. (T-1) Note: Contractor managed accounts must have a government accountable officer appointed. The government accountable officer can either be the functional area chief, quality assurance evaluator, or other appointed government individual who is qualified in the appropriate AFSC. The government accountable officer may sign for one or all of the different type accounts at a particular location as approved by the MAJCOM. (T-2) A2.2. By Type Account (FB/FE). Core AFSC 21R3/4 or their civilian equivalents, or fully qualified SNCO, AFSC 2S000/90/71, may be appointed when approved by the MAJCOM. (T-2) The MAJCOM A4R may waive the AFSC or qualification requirements for the accountable position if extenuating circumstances exist. Note: Contractor managed accounts must have a government accountable officer appointed. The government accountable officer can either be the functional area chief, quality assurance evaluator, or other appointed government individual who is qualified in the appropriate AFSC. The government accountable officer may sign for one or all of the different type accounts at a particular location as approved by the MAJCOM. A2.3. Contingency Supply Accounts (FB/FE). Air Force lead-major Command/Combatant Numbered Air Force A4R tasked for Combat Command (COCOM) support will appoint accountable and/or responsible officers for supply system stocks in the FB/FE accounts. (T-1) Accountable/responsible officers will be the senior core AFSC 21R3/4 logistics readiness officers, or SNCO s in AFSC 2S000/90/71 (i.e. Expeditionary LRS Commander or ranking Logistics Readiness Officer (LRO) as appropriate). The lead-major Command/Combatant Numbered Air Force A4R may waive the AFSC or qualification requirements for the responsible officer position of FB/FE accounts if extenuating circumstances exist. A2.4. Depot Supply (FD). Core AFSC 21R4 officer or permanent civil servant in grade GS-11 or higher. A2.5. Munitions Supply (FV). Refer to AFI , Conventional Munitions Maintenance Management, for all conventional munitions account Munitions Accountable Systems Officer (MASO) AFSC/experience/training requirements. Refer to AFI , Nuclear Accountability Procedures, for all nuclear munitions account Munitions Accountable Systems Officer AFSC/experience/training requirements. A2.6. Base Fuels/Satellite (FP). The Defense Logistics Agency (DLA) Energy is the DoD Integrated Materiel Manager (IMM) and the DoD Executive Agent for Defense Working Capital Funds (DWCF) owned Class III Bulk petroleum products. DLA Energy is the accountable office/officer for FP accounts. Correspondingly, the responsible officer, is a government employee who is a U.S. citizen (military or civilian) appointed by proper authority to exercise care, custody, and safe-keeping of Government property. In accordance with Defense Energy

12 10 AFI OCTOBER 2013 Support Center (DESC)-P-7 (DESC-P-7 supersedes DoD M Chapter 10, Section B guidance regarding appointment and responsibilities for responsible officers) any AFSC 21R3/4 officer upon completion of Logistics Readiness Officer technical training; GS-9 equivalent civilians, or SNCOs with AFSC 2F000/91/71 may be the fuels responsible officer. AFSC 21R3/4 officers, GS-9 equivalent civilians (or higher) or SNCOs with AFSC 2F000/91/71 must also meet training requirements for responsible officers as indicated in DoD M, DoD Management of Bulk Petroleum Products, Natural Gas, and Coal, Volume II, Chapter 10 and AFI , Fuels Management. DESC-P-7. Additionally, NCOs and civilians must attend the Petroleum Logistics Management Course (PLMC). They must attend PLMC and complete DLA Energy responsible officer training. Exceptions to the minimum grade level may be waived by DLA Energy-FI on a case-by-case basis for small fuels accounts where the minimum grade level requirements cannot be met by an otherwise qualified person. (T-3) A2.7. Base Civil Engineer (FC). AFSC 21R3/4, or 32X3 officer. If an officer is not available, AFSC 2S071/90/00, 3EX7X/90/00, or civilian equivalent filling the position of Chief or Superintendent of Operations, may serve. Accountable officers will attend the Logistics Management Course, MGT 438, at the Air Force Institute of Technology, Civil Engineering and Services School. (T-3) A2.8. Medical Supply (FM). The base Medical Treatment Facility Commander will appoint a Medical Service Corps officer, AFSC 41AX, as accountable Base Medical Supply officer. If an officer is not assigned to the Medical Logistics Flight, the AFMOA/SGALS, in coordination with the Chief, Medical Logistics Division, Air Force Medical Support Agency, may waiver appointment of a civilian equivalent in the grade of GS-11 or higher, or a fully qualified SNCO (AFSC 4A1XX). For ANG units, the assistant USPFO serves as the accountable Medical Supply officer. A2.9. Weapon Systems Account (FW). Any AFSC 21R3/4 officer or civilian equivalent can be the accountable officer. Force Support Squadron: A2.10. Food Services (FT). AFSC 38F/38P3/4 officer or civilian equivalent. If a qualified officer or civilian is not available, a SNCO in any AFSC may be assigned upon approval of HQ AFPC/SV. Note: Contractor managed accounts must have a government accountable officer appointed. (T-2) The government accountable officer can either be the functional area chief, quality assurance evaluator, or other appointed government individual who is qualified in the appropriate AFSC. A2.11. Base Library (FL). The Force Support Squadron Commander or Civilian Leader appoints a professional librarian as the accountable property agent for all library materiel and services. The Force Support Squadron Commander/Civilian leader, or a specialized organization with a library of information center appoints an interim accountable property agent during periods when there isn t an assigned librarian. A2.12. Force Support Squadron (FF). The Force Support Squadron Commander (CC)/Civilian Leader (CL) (AFSC 38P or civilian equivalent) is the accountable officer for FF accounts. Note: Contractor managed accounts must have a government accountable officer appointed. (T-2) The government accountable officer can either be the functional area chief, quality assurance evaluator, or other appointed government individual who is qualified in the appropriate AFSC.

13 AFI OCTOBER A2.13. Miscellaneous Accounts (FX). No AFSC restriction. Note: Contractor managed accounts must have a government accountable officer appointed. (T-2) The government accountable officer can either be the functional area chief, quality assurance evaluator, or other appointed government individual who is qualified in the appropriate AFSC. The government accountable officer may sign for one or all of the different type accounts at a particular location as approved by the MAJCOM.
